/*
 * MAX_PLUGIN_MANIFEST_BYTES — upper bound on validator plugin manifests
 * accepted by the Sievewell loader. Manifests larger than this are
 * rejected before signature verification to limit parser exposure to
 * untrusted input. Raising this value widens the pre-auth attack
 * surface; any change requires security review. The limit was last
 * validated against the build noted below.
 */

pipeline stamp: htk4_ae36

**Ticket: Config drift in Scanbridge integration**

The barcode scanner integration on the Ferrowick kiosks has drifted from the published baseline. Plugin authors: third-party plugins must not override device polling settings — drift traced to two plugins doing exactly that. Revert any local overrides and pin to the baseline. The canonical configuration values follow.

deployment values, tafof-taduf:
pelius:
  pin: 6508
  tenant: praiel
  seal: seal_4e33a2f4
  metrics_host: metrics.pelius.plorvagrid.corp
  standby_team: druix
  escalation: juldor-norius
  nonce: 5db598

Handover Note — Re: Calloway Fabrication Term Sheet

For the finance team via incoming director. Status: Calloway's revised term sheet arrived last week. Key points: 18-month exclusivity on the Norvale components, volume commitments ramping from month six, and a co-funded tooling clause capped at agreed limits. Outstanding items are the termination triggers and the indexation formula. Legal has marked both for negotiation. The confidential planning context sits below.

management briefing: Headcount on the Quenael team goes from 9 to 80 by the end of July. Gross margin on Quenael came in at 15 percent against a plan of 20 percent.